CSS是前端開發非常重要的一部分,它可以讓我們更好地控制網頁的樣式。其中,規則定義是CSS中最常用、最基礎的命令之一。下面,我們來詳細了解一下CSS規則定義的八個不同的命令。
/* CSS規則定義的基礎語法 */ selector { property: value; }
其中,selector就是我們要控制的元素,property表示元素要改變的屬性,value則是屬性要改變到的值。
/* CSS規則定義的八個命令 */ .class { property: value; } #id { property: value; } element { property: value; } element, element { property: value; } element.class { property: value; } element > element { property: value; } element + element { property: value; } [attribute="value"] { property: value; }
上述八個命令分別是:
1. 類選擇器:以"."開頭,表示選擇具有該類名的所有元素。
2. ID選擇器:以"#"開頭,表示選擇具有該ID的元素。
3. 元素選擇器:表示選擇該元素類型的所有元素。
4. 多元素選擇器:用逗號分隔,表示同時選擇多個元素類型的所有元素。
5. 類與元素結合選擇器:表示選擇該元素類型中帶有該類名的所有元素。
6. 子元素選擇器:表示選擇該元素的子元素。
7. 相鄰元素選擇器:表示選擇該元素的下一個相鄰元素。
8. 屬性選擇器:用中括號括起來,表示選擇帶有指定屬性和值的元素。
上一篇css規則列表是干嘛的
下一篇css控制樣式的單詞